In order for a will to be legitimate, it needs to be: made by a person who is 18 years of ages or over andmade voluntarily and without pressure from any other person andmade by an individual who is of sound mind.

A witness or the married partner of a witness can not benefit from a will. If a witness is a recipient (or the married partner or civil partner of a beneficiary), the will is still valid but the recipient will not be able to inherit under the will. Although it will be legally legitimate even if it is not dated, it is suggested to make sure that the will likewise includes the date on which it is signed.

If someone makes a will however it is not lawfully valid, on their death their estate will be shared out under certain guidelines, not according to the desires expressed in the will. If you want to deposit a will in this way you must go to the District Pc registry or Probate Sub-Registry or compose to: Someone near you might have passed away and you believe they made a will however you can't discover one in their house. Check to see if you can discover a certificate of deposit, which will have been sent to them if they scheduled the will to be kept by the Principal Windows Registry of the Family Division.

If the person died in a care home or a healthcare facility you could check to see if the will was entrusted them. You need to likewise get in touch with the person's solicitor, accountant or bank to see if they hold the will. The individual who has actually passed away, or their solicitor, might have registered their will with an industrial organisation such as Certainty () and, after the person's death, you can spend for a search of the wills signed up on the business's database.

If you can't discover a will, you will generally need to deal with the estate of the person who has died as if they passed away without leaving a will. Any apparent alterations on the face of the will are assumed to have actually been made at a later date and so do not form part of the original lawfully legitimate will. The only way you can alter a will is by making: a codicil to the will ora new will A codicil is a supplement to a will that makes some alterations however leaves the rest of it intact.
